← Back to all jobs

This job has been posted a while ago and might no longer be available.

Javascript Engineer (Frontend)


The top priority of our user-driven team is the happiness of our drivers. From the moment they decide to join us until they enter our marketplace, drivers will be using our products. Our mission is to make sure they get the stellar experience they deserve. Given our very large business scope (drivers acquisition, retention and well-being), our team is working side by side with frontend, mobile, product and design teams, allowing us to build features that will empower drivers with new ways to drive and earn.

From the inside, we’re a caring full-stack team of engineers (iOS, Android, Frontend, Backend, QA) who share the same values: 
• Transparency: We discuss everything openly. 
• Team Unity: No one is left behind. 
• Move Fast: No need to demonstrate for days, just do it. 
• Knowledge Sharing: Whether it's organizational, cultural or technical, we're eager to learn! 
• It's OK to fail: Succeed together, learn together. With the many new challenges, we’re facing every day,

Our team is seeking a product aficionado that will help us take our services to the next level. The ideal candidate is someone who has a passion for building software people genuinely love using, has strong problem-solving skills and exhibits empathy for our users.

What Happens Next Will Surprise You! 😂

As a Javascript developer in the Driver Growth Team, you will have the responsibility for improving and expanding our suite of web-based products, building out our developer tools and contributing to our overall frontend architecture. You will be an integral member of an autonomous and distributed product team where no detail is ever overlooked and you will be expected to contribute to our product roadmap. The right person will be a self-motivated and passionate Javascript engineer with a love for, and deep understanding of UX. You keep abreast of the latest trends in the Javascript ecosystem and understand when, and if, a trend should be introduced to a stack or workflow. You enjoy pairing and collaborating with others when solving problems but can stand on your own feet and take full ownership of projects. 

Design and contribute to a shared component library to ensure consistency across our apps. Design and build well crafted and optimized frontend experiences for both mobile and desktop. Advocate for, and introduce, improvements to our frontend stack (development, testing, CI, automation, and architecture). Design simple solutions to solve difficult problems. Standardise all client-side logic and work with the back-end teams to improve the way we handle our data-flow. 

• Write clean, performant, modular and well-tested JavaScript for mobile and desktop. 
• Participate in code reviews and provide feedback to your colleagues. 
• Leave code better than you found it. 
• Deploy, monitor and maintain your applications in production. 
• Lead by example. 
• Share knowledge with your team and help them grow.


• 3+ years as a Frontend Engineer. 
• Excellent knowledge of Javascript / ES6. 
• Production experience of React. 
• Awareness and understanding of technical constraints. 
• Not afraid of stepping out of your technical comfort zone. 
• Fluent in English.

• Stocks. 
• Paid conference attendance/travel. 
• Heetch credits. 
• A Spotify subscription.  
• Code retreats and company retreats. 
• Travel budget (visit your remote co-workers and our offices).